XAMPPサーバーでMySQLが稼働しなくなった

2025/12/14 6:33:22作成
コントロールパネルからXAMPPサーバーを起動しようとすると次のようなエラーが発生し、MySQLが稼働しなくなりました。その原因はサーバーを終了(Quitで終了)させずに起動させたことによるもののようです。しかしながら頻繁に発生するのでなにか他にも原因があるのかもしれません。

[mysql] Error: MySQL shutdown unexpectedly.
[mysql] This may be due to a blocked port, missing dependencies,
[mysql] improper privileges, a crash, or a shutdown by another method.
[mysql] Press the Logs button to view error logs and check
[mysql] the Windows Event Viewer for more clues
[mysql] If you need more help, copy and post this
[mysql] entire log window on the forums

Xampp/htdocsフォルダ内のxoops cubeのデータを保存し、Xamppを再インストールした上でxoops cubeを再インストールしデータベースを流し込めば復活するのですがこれでは時間と手間が掛かります。今回は別の方法で試してみることにしました。

手順
1.Xampp内のmysqlフォルダ内のdataフォルダの中にあるファイルを全て消去します。(念のため保存しても良いかもしれません)

2.同じくXampp内のmysqlフォルダ内のbackupフォルダの中にあるファイル全てをコピーし先ほどのdataフォルダの中にコピーします。

3.これでXamppは初期化されますが、既にphpMyaAminのconfig.incファイルで設定されているパスワードが存在しているのでこれを消去してからXamppを起動し、サーバーのパスワードを再設定します。

4.xoops cubeのデータベースはないのでデータベースを作成しその中にxoops cubeのデータベースを流し込みます。

5.これでxoops cubeのホームページが起動しますが、このままではprotecterモジュールによって正常に立ち上がりません。

6.ホームページのアドレス/user.phpからユーザーログインし、同じアドレスから管理メニューを表示しprotecterモジュールの一般設定のサイト改ざんチェック値という項目の値を消去します。

以上でローカルサーバーでxoops cubeのホームページを復活させることが出来ました。
投票数:0 平均点:0.00

趣味を楽しもう新着記事

欲しい商品が必ず見つかるメジャーなネットショップ

ログイン

オンライン状況

35 人のユーザが現在オンラインです。 - 2 人のユーザが 趣味を楽しもう を参照しています。.

登録ユーザ 0 ゲスト 35

Facebookリンク表示

検索

アクセスカウンタ

今日 : 288
昨日 : 818
総計 : 2231124